I’m trying out AUTOOPTIMIZE for the first time and I’m not getting what I expect.
Running: BaseX 8.3 beta ec9b627
A new database is created with a single document which has TEXTINDEX, ATTRINDEX, UPDINDEX and AUTOOPTIMISE all set to true.
This is what INFO DATABASE shows (as I expect):

Now I add a new document (or more than one) to the database. I expect that Up-to-date will still be true and that AUTOOPTIMIZE will still be true. But what I see is both are now false:

Perhaps this is the expected behaviour and I’ve misunderstood AUTOOPTIMIZE? Or is there a bug?
